( 1 ) We are seniors who have - and health issues and in - of 2014 I asked our lender if they had any suggestions/help for us with our mortgage. I specifically said I was not interested in a short sale, nor were we in jeopardy of foreclosure as we have never missed a payment and did not intend to. ( 2 ) I was sent an application but said on the application I was only hoping to look at options - perhaps a different percentage rate, or possibly just a fixed rate. I tried calling numerous times trying to tell people that I just wanted to talk to someone about my options but no one would return my phone calls. ( 3 ) In - we got a decline on assistance with our loan and that we were not eligible for FORECLOSURE alternatives. - Due to the reason I was not evaluated on other criteria ''. I had no idea what this meant and tried to call but my phone calls were never answered. Shortly from the decline we got a letter sending us information on selling our house on a SHORT SALE! I

( 6 ) In response to my letter a person called and I asked her to remove the fee from the statement. She said she would have to check into it and see what it was for. Many months later she called and said that the fee was for an appraisal. I replied that I did not ask or give permission for an appraisal nor was I sent a copy of the appraisal which by new laws they must send to me promptly. ( 7 ) A month later I was sent what they called an appraisal. ( It has now been at least six months later ) It was not an appraisal - it was an exterior BPO and done by a realtor and not a certified appraiser. I have a real estate license and I know that according to FIRREA rules that we can not do appraisals for mortgage loans as this is illegal. It also states that if lenders wish to ensure payment for appraisals they must request payment before. ( Strangely I was studying the new laws of the CFPB for my continuing education in real estate in -. ) ( - ) As I have found out that getting help with mortgages from the government is a big farce I feel I should not have to pay for an appraisal which I was told was a mistake, and which it says right on it that it is NOT an appraisal, and I certainly did not receive it promptly. Asking for help with my mortgage not only has caused a lot more stress for us, but now I have more money to pay and a lower FICO score.
